>>>>> "James" == James Tison <address@hidden> writes:
James> Werner, Paul:
James> Yet another workaround -- this one only works in z/OS V1R2 and
James> higher: add
James> -Wc,HALTON\(CCN3296\)
James> to your command line (or xxxFLAGS), leaving _ACCEPTABLE_RC
James> alone. This should bypass the little normal warning stuff and
James> stop whenever the error message announcing unfound headers is
James> present.
